    If you want Ethel to farrow in the chicken coop, you need to put some wood bumper bars all around the edges, or she'll smother them. Also, block off a corner where Ethel can't get to, and put a heat light up in that corner and cordon it off with a 2x4, big enough for a litter in a triangular fashion(corner to corner). Piglets #1 that kills is the cold, and a close 2nd is mom laying on them. I'd hate for you or the girls coming to find that. It just can happen so easily. I can't wait to see those piglets!
